Planate Management Group is Hiring a Structural Engineer (Washington, DC Near Baltimore, MD

Planate Management Group (PMG) is a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) headquartered in Alexandria, Virginia, and Orlando, Florida USA with technical support centers in South East Asia and East Africa, that provide program management and facilities engineering services worldwide. Planate is a small business provider of planning, design, infrastructure management, technical consulting, engineering, and construction management services in support of the US Department of Defense (DOD) and its Service (Army, Air Force, Navy, Marine Corps) missions, along with other US federal agencies, all over the world.

The Structural Engineer, will play a pivotal role in providing engineering support, handling and managing assigned design projects consistent with the planning and design goals and standards as established, and you are responsible for ensuring the completion of the design work and participating in planning the phases to prevent disruption and help minimize overall costs.

Key responsibilities:

  • Perform professional engineering and project management work to protect life, safety, health, and property
  • Provide civil or structural professional consultations on a wide range of difficult unforeseen problems on design interfaces, repairs, designs, and construction
  • Review designs, plans and specifications to ensure structural safe facilities
  • Review preliminary and final engineering plans, specifications and cost estimates of architect and engineering firms or another government agency to ensure design excellence and compliance with specifications
  • Provide expertise to team on projects for construction, renovations, and improvements to facilities
  • Provide expert technical assistance and guidance on maintenance, repair, renovation, and construction work
  • Assist in analyzing the critical path schedule for design and construction projects
  • Prepare, review, and approve project documents including building and system designs, estimates, specifications and bid packages
  • Administer the acquisition documents for design, construction, renovation, and repair
  • Ensure that designs and specifications meet structural requirements and construction

Qualifications to be successful in the role:

  • Must be a graduate of Bachelor’s degree in Civil/ Structural Engineering.
  • Must be a registered Professional Engineer (P.E.).
  • Must have 5 years relevant construction experience i.e. government projects.
  • Able to read and interpret acquisition policy, regulations, and directives.
  • Must be experienced in assessing and responding to Requests for Information (RFI)
  • Able to provide clear guidance to all lower-level acquisition personnel.
  • Able to communicate effectively, both orally and in writing
  • Must be able to understand and interpret structural drawings and have a basic understanding of the principals and how they fit in with other engineering disciplines.
  • Knowledgeable of Construction Safety regulations, i.e. EM 385-1-1, OSHA, etc.
